Grizzlies player Brandon Clarke's cause of death released by LA County Medical Examiner
Key Points:
- Memphis Grizzlies forward Brandon Clarke died in May due to accidental effects of heroin and cocaine, according to the Los Angeles County Medical Examiner.
- Clarke, 29, was found dead in a San Fernando Valley home on May 11, where drug paraphernalia was also discovered.
- Clarke was under contract with the Grizzlies through the 2026-27 season and had played all seven of his professional seasons with the team after college at Gonzaga.
- Approximately six weeks before his death, Clarke was arrested in Arkansas on charges including speeding, reckless driving, and possession of a controlled substance.
